Taking An Interdisciplinary Approach Which Straddles Law, Anthropology Sociology And Women'S Studies, Mirhosseini Shows How Women Can Turn Even The Most Patriarchal Elements Of Islamic Law To Their Advantage And Achieve Their Personal Marital Aims.
